The Galaxy A50s is a bit better than Huawei Mate 50E, with a score of 86.6 against 78.9. The Galaxy A50s comes with Android 10 OS, while Huawei Mate 50E has HarmonyOS 3 OS. Even though Galaxy A50s is noticeably older than Huawei Mate 50E, it's body is somewhat lighter and just a little thinner.
Huawei Mate 50E features a little better performance than Galaxy A50s, and although they both have a Octa-Core CPU, the Huawei Mate 50E also has more RAM memory. The Huawei Mate 50E counts with a little sharper screen than Galaxy A50s, because it has a slightly higher 1224 x 2700 resolution, a little bit larger screen and a just a little better pixel count per inch in the screen.
The Galaxy A50s counts with a lot bigger memory capacity to install games and applications than Huawei Mate 50E, and although they both have exactly the same internal memory, the Galaxy A50s also has a slot for external memory cards that holds up to 512 GB. Galaxy A50s takes way better videos and photos than Huawei Mate 50E, although it has a lot smaller aperture and a camera with lesser megapixels.
The Huawei Mate 50E features just a little bit longer battery duration than Galaxy A50s, because it has a 4460mAh battery capacity.
